. Below is a summarized overview and resources for Indian Polity notes based on recent materials. Core Content of M. Laxmikanth's Polity
The book is typically divided into several key parts that cover the entire spectrum of the Indian political system: Constitutional Framework
: Includes the historical background (Acts like the Regulating Act of 1773 to the Independence Act of 1947), making of the Constitution, salient features, Preamble, Union and its territory, Citizenship, Fundamental Rights, Directive Principles, and Fundamental Duties. System of Government
: Details on the Parliamentary system, Federal system, Center-State relations, Inter-state relations, and Emergency provisions. Central Government
: Covers the President, Vice-President, Prime Minister, Council of Ministers, and the Parliament (including committees and forums). State & Local Government
: Examination of the Governor, Chief Minister, State Legislature, High Courts, and the grassroots level via Panchayati Raj and Municipalities. Constitutional & Non-Constitutional Bodies
: Detailed sections on the Election Commission, UPSC, Finance Commission, CAG, NITI Aayog (replacing Planning Commission), NHRC, etc. Vajiram & Ravi Available Note Formats (PDF/Handwritten) UPSC Polity Notes 2026, Topic wise, Download PDF Not all notes are equal

Q1: Is the 7th edition of M Laxmikant enough for UPSC 2025? A: Yes, but you must supplement it with a current affairs magazine for the latest amendments. The 8th edition is better, but the 7th + current notes works fine.
Q2: Can I clear Polity without reading the whole book, just a PDF summary? A: No. Summary notes are for revision, not for first-time learning. Read the full book once, then switch to your notes PDF.
Q3: Is Laxmikant sufficient for Ethics or International Relations? A: No. Laxmikant is only for Indian Polity. For IR, refer to newspapers. For Ethics, refer to a separate lexicon.
